PopSugar had a one-on-one with "Vampire Diaries" Season 7 star Ian Somerhalder and he dished out some awesome details regarding the upcoming season.

The newlywed Ian Somerhalder said that his character Damon Salvatore is a "hands-down lushy, smarmy drunk." He also pointed out that Damon and Bonnie had that love-hate relationship which "sounds like a beautiful recipe for disaster and amazingness."

The hunky actor further expressed that "Vampire Diaries" Season 7 will see the old Damon back. "Damon was this super volatile and very unpredictable guy. He wasn't very a nice a lot of the time, but he was vulnerable. People can respect that, and it draws them in," the actor said.

That is definitely interesting and something to look forward to for Damon fans who are aching to find out how he would handle the love of his life being temporarily out of the picture.

Meanwhile, there would be new additions to spice things up in Mystic Falls. According to The Wrap, Tim Kang and Todd Lasance will join the CW supernatural drama.

Kang is Oscar, an easygoing stoner who hides a surprising association with the Salvatores. His relaxed lifestyle will be interrupted when an intervention via supernatural ways transforms him into a savage killer.

Lasance on the other hand is Julian, depicted as a feared and legendary immortal who is renowned for excelling in earthly amusements. He fears ambiguity which is an unlikely outcome since he's constantly on the run, leaving pandemonium in his wake.

Returning stars include Paul Wesley, Candice Accola, Michael Malarkey, Ian Somerhalder and Kat Graham. Since its leading lady was written off, focus on the succeeding seasons would be on Stefan and Damon, the Salvatore brothers.
